Don't underestimate the power of a pregnant woman, especially if she's Cardi B.
On Sunday, the Grammy-nominated rapper performed a 30-minute set at Coachella and didn't let her pregnancy stop her from dancing all over the stage.
SEE ALSO:Beyoncé's Coachella set has people ready to enroll in her universityThe "Bodak Yellow" star performed most of her new album Invasion of Privacy,but therewas song in particular that got the soon-to-be mother twerking. She removed her jacket and started moving to "She Bad," featuring YG.

At one point, she mentioned to the crowd, "I'm running out of breath, you know my pregnant ass." She can still dance way more than any of us can - pregnant or not.
We're still unsure how many months she has left, since she announced the pregnancy on Saturday Night Live just a few weeks ago, but either way her dropping low and busting a move surprised many of her fans.
It even brought out a few memes on how her unborn baby must feel about Cardi's movements all over the Coachella stage.

Aside from YG, she also brought out Kehlani, Chance The Rapper, G-Eazy, and 21 Savage to perform with her.
Cardi B has been killing the game with her hit singles and certified gold album, so we can't imagine anything slowing her down now.
